Browns GM Berry Won't Name QB Starter But Details Sanders' Needs

Cleveland Browns GM Andrew Berry declined to name a starting quarterback but outlined specific expectations for rookie Shedeur Sanders, emphasizing efficiency and ball security.

Berry stated the team does not need to make a decision soon and expects all quarterbacks in the room to compete. While Sanders threw for 1,400 yards with seven touchdowns and 10 interceptions as a rookie, Berry emphasized the need for continued growth, specifically regarding ball security and efficiency.
